    The 2026 Family Law Symposium

    On Jan. 23 and 24, join hundreds of family law attorneys, judges, paralegals and other related professionals at the Hyatt Regency in New Brunswick for New Jersey's premier family law event – the 2026 Family Law Symposium! Reserve your seat today to hear thought-provoking and insightful presentations from many of the state's leading lawyers and judges, and to network with colleagues and other family law professionals.

    This year's symposium features three dedicated segments on complex issues in custody matters. Each segment will focus on one of three vital topics in family law: substance abuse, sexual abuse allegations and learning disabilities. Additional cutting-edge topics include creative arguments around equitable distribution and innovative theories in litigation.

    The symposium also includes the topics that you depend on, such as the top 10 reported and unreported cases of the previous year.

    Death and Family Law

    Join us for The Family Law Symposium Friday night seminar.

    What happens when death collides with family litigation? This comprehensive seminar guides family law practitioners through the complex challenges that arise when a party dies during or after matrimonial or non-dissolution proceedings.

    Our distinguished panel will explore the following topics:

    • How to proceed if one party to a divorce action dies during the litigation
    • How to properly present evidence to support the equitable distribution factors if one party is deceased
    • How to proceed if a party in a non-dissolution action dies
    • If child support from a parent ends when that parent dies
    • Custody, parenting time, and visitation issues that arise when one parent dies. Do grandparents have rights, do siblings, do aunts and uncles
    • Appropriate language to use in settlement agreements and wills to provide for a child's care, custody, and support in the event one parent (or both) dies after the divorce
    • Collecting legal fees from the estate of a deceased client
    • Effective use of life insurance
